[PATCH 03/12] ARM: at91: Export at91_pmc_base

After commit b55149529d26 (ARM: at91/PMC: make register base soc independent)
building atmel_usba_udc as a module fails with following message
ERROR: "at91_pmc_base" [drivers/usb/gadget/atmel_usba_udc.ko] undefined!
make[1]: *** [__modpost] Error 1
make: *** [modules] Error 2

Export symbol to allow driver to be built as a module again.

arch/arm/mach-at91/clock.c |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/arch/arm/mach-at91/clock.c b/arch/arm/mach-at91/clock.c
index a0f4d74..6b69282 100644
--- a/arch/arm/mach-at91/clock.c
+++ b/arch/arm/mach-at91/clock.c
@@ -35,6 +35,7 @@
#include "generic.h"

void __iomem *at91_pmc_base;
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(at91_pmc_base);
